What is a transfer pricing associate?

Transfer Pricing Associates are professionals who help companies set and document the prices for goods, services, or intellectual property transferred between related entities within a multinational organization. Their main role is to ensure that these prices comply with international tax laws and regulations, minimizing tax risks and avoiding penalties. They typically conduct economic analyses, benchmark studies, and prepare transfer pricing documentation to support the company’s pricing policies. Transfer Pricing Associates often work closely with tax, legal, and finance teams, as well as external tax authorities during audits or inquiries.

What are common challenges faced by transfer pricing associates in their daily work?

Transfer Pricing Associates often encounter the challenge of interpreting and applying complex international tax regulations, which can vary significantly across jurisdictions. Another common hurdle is gathering and analyzing large volumes of financial and operational data from different divisions within a multinational organization. Collaboration with tax, legal, and finance teams is essential to ensure compliance and to develop defensible transfer pricing documentation. Additionally, staying updated on frequently changing global transfer pricing laws and OECD guidelines requires continuous learning and adaptability.

Senior Tax Manager, Transfer Pricing

NextGenEnergyJobs

Atlanta, GA • On-site

$140 - $190/hr

Other

Posted 5 days ago


Job description

Work with a Top 20 CPA and advisory firm that Accounts for Anything.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ead transfer pricing engagements from planning through final delivery across a diverse client and industry portfolio.
  • Develop and guide the transfer pricing approach based on each client’s facts, intercompany transactions, operational structure, and business objectives.
  • Prepare and review transfer pricing studies, documentation, local files, master files, and related technical deliverables.
  • Review benchmarking and economic analyses, including comparable data sets and arm’s-length ranges.
  • Analyze intercompany transactions involving areas such as royalties, services, management fees, and transfers between related entities.
  • Apply strong knowledge of U.S. transfer pricing regulations while incorporating relevant OECD transfer pricing guidelines.
  • Lead client calls, explain technical concepts clearly, identify missing information, and manage financial and operational information requests.
  • Respond to technical client questions and help clients navigate complex transfer pricing considerations.
  • Direct project teams, assign work, review deliverables, and provide technical guidance and meaningful feedback to senior associates.
  • Perform higher-level and final-quality reviews to ensure deliverables are accurate, technically sound, timely, and ready for client delivery.
  • Manage multiple engagements, priorities, deadlines, budgets, workflow, billing, and overall project execution.
  • Collaborate with partners and practice leaders on engagement strategy, technical decisions, client opportunities, and the continued growth of the transfer pricing function.
Requirements
  • Approximately 10 or more years of progressive transfer pricing experience within public accounting, professional services, consulting, or a comparable environment.
  • Demonstrated experience independently leading U.S. transfer pricing engagements and owning projects through final delivery.
  • Strong technical knowledge of U.S. transfer pricing regulations and familiarity with OECD transfer pricing guidelines.
  • Experience preparing and reviewing transfer pricing documentation, studies, benchmarking analyses, local files, and/or master files.
  • Ability to assess complex client fact patterns, ask thoughtful questions, and determine the financial, operational, and technical information required.
  • Experience leading project teams and providing direction, review, coaching, and technical support to developing professionals.
  • Strong client communication skills, including the ability to explain complex technical concepts in a clear, practical manner.
  • A proactive and highly organized approach to client follow-up, project tracking, deadlines, and deliverables.
  • Ability to manage a high volume of concurrent engagements while maintaining quality, responsiveness, and attention to detail.
  • Broad industry exposure and the ability to adapt transfer pricing knowledge to different business models and transactions.
  • Bachelor’s degree in economics, finance, accounting, taxation, or a related field.
  • CPA, JD, LLM, or enrolled agent credential is valued but not required.
